How to Remove Remote Desktop Screenshot
Uninstall of Remote Desktop Screenshot is easy.
You have a few option to remove Remote Desktop Screenshot:
- You can choose menu "Uninstall Remote Desktop Screenshot" from the Remote Desktop Screenshot group in the Windows Start Menu.
Just click "Unistall" and the software will be removed from your system.
- Head to the Start menu and select Control Panel then select Uninstall a program.
Find Remote Desktop Screenshot in the list and choose "unistall"
